TOWN OF LUSK
COUNCIL MEETING
AGENDA
DATE: September 2, 2014 PLACE: Lusk Town Hall
TIME: 5:00 p.m. TYPE: Regular Meeting
1. Call to Order – Mayor Patricia Smith
2. Resignation of Councilmember Jon Mellott – moved from previous agenda by Mayor Smith, read by Mayor Smith
3. Swearing in of new Councilmember – Doug Greenough – Moved from previous agenda, administered by Town Attorney Dennis Meier
4. Approval of the Agenda – Councilmember Kupke moved, Councilmember Tirado second, motion carried
5. Approval of the Bills – Councilmember Kupke moved, Councilmember Tirado second, motion carried
6. Treasurer’s Report – Financial Condition & Manual Checks – Filed for Audit – Councilmember Tirado moved, Councilmember Kupke second, motion carried
7. Approval of Minutes – August 5, 2014, Regular Council Meeting – Councilmember Kupke moved, Councilmember Tirado second, motion carried
8. Visitors - None
9. Department Updates
• Royce Thompson – Electric Superintendent and Airport Manager
• James Santistevan – Cemetery & Parks
• Cory See – Golf Course Superintendent
• Kathy Johnson – Animal Control
• Linda Frye – Clerk/Treasurer
• Todd Skrukrud – Director of Public Works
10. Old Business
1. GIS Software – Exhibit 4, Authorized Entity Acknowledgement Statement & Addendum to the Joint Agreement to Take Advantage of a Regional Government Enterprise License Agreement, ESRI – Regional Government Enterprise License Authorized Entity Contact Information. Payment to Niobrara County for the use of the GIS Software – Councilmember Tirado moved, Councilmember Kupke second, motion carried
2. Ordinance No. 11-5-200, An Ordinance Amending Existing Ordinance No. 11-5-200, Which Establishes Amended Garbage and Refuse Collections Rates, Second Reading – Councilmember Tirado moved, Councilmember Kupke second, motion carried
11. New Business
1. Information on request for variance – Richard and Debra Murray – Councilmember Kupke moved, second by Councilmember Tirado to approve the variance with the stipulation that there are no objects at the public hearing, motion carried
2. Police Department Vehicle Bids – White’s Energy Motors Gillette, WY & Greiner Ford, Douglas, WY – Councilmember Tirado moved, Councilmember Kupke second to accept the lowest bid from Greiner Motor Company Douglas, motion carried
3. Verbal offer for the undeveloped acres west of the Business Park – Tabled pending more information
4. Niobrara Country Club Addition, Deck – Councilmember Tirado moved, Councilmember Kupke second to approve the addition of a deck at the Country Club
12. Mayor’s Remark
1. Proclamation – Wyoming Public Radio – Mayor Smith read
13. Other - None
14. Adjourn - 5:25 p.m.
15. Next Meeting October 7, 2014
